LABUAN (Feb 3): The Labuan Education Department will soon have a new purpose-built premise with the upcoming construction of the RM100 million Kompleks Jabatan Pendidikan Labuan. The project, located at Kampung Batu Kalam, is expected to begin at the end of this year.
Datuk Wan Hashim Wan Rahim, the Deputy Secretary General (Planning and Development) of the Ministry of Education (MoE), confirmed that the project was approved under the 12th Malaysia Plan and will be implemented and overseen by the Public Works Department (PWD).
“The construction of this complex is great news for the education staff who have long been operating from rented premises at the Financial Park Complex. Once completed, this new facility will be a source of pride,” said Wan Hashim after attending the completion ceremony of the preschool new block project at SK Patau-Patau earlier Monday.
He said the new complex will be built on the existing land of the Sektor Pembelajaran Jabatan Pendidikan Labuan Bukit Kalam, marking a significant milestone for the local education sector.
The new preschool building block at SK Patau-Patau was completed on schedule at a cost of RM919,098.40.
The fast-track project, executed within 30 weeks, was closely monitored to ensure smooth progress and timely completion.
Labuan Public Works Department (JKR) director Mohd Faizul Mohd Ali Hanapiah said the additional building block was developed using an in-depth in-house design by its architecture team.
“We have designed a facility that caters to preschool children, incorporating child-friendly learning spaces, an eating area, and restrooms,” he told Bernama after handing over the completed project to the Ministry of Education.
Mohd Faizul said the project commenced on May 14, 2024, and was completed on Dec 19, 2024.
He emphasised that the successful completion of the project reflects the government’s commitment to enhancing the education ecosystem.
“We will continue to collaborate with the MoE to provide a conducive learning environment for our children,” he said. – Bernama
